Elamipretide is a cardiolipin peroxidase inhibitor and mitochondria-targeting peptide under the development of Stealth BioTherapeutics. It can Improve left Ventricular and Mitochondrial Function. Elamipretide can alleviate mitochondrial dysfunction and oxidative damage in human trabecular meshwork cells. It can prevent both iHTM and GTM(3) cells from sustained oxidative stress induced by H(2)O(2). Phase II clinical trials for the treatment of Chronic heart failure and Mitochondrial myopathies are ongoing.
